Q. What's a credit score? Where do you get these? A. Credit scores on Getloaded are provided by TransCredit, a well-known credit reporting service. The
breakdown of the scores is as follows:
Too new to rate: 0 High risk: 1-39 Increased risk: 40-59 Moderate risk: 60-
79 Lowest risk: 80-100
The major factors used in determining a company's credit score are the number of years in
business, the company's credit references, credit history, and their average payment trend in
days. Please contact TransCredit at 800-215-8448 for a copy of any credit report. Credit scores
on Getloaded.com are updated every 24 hours.

Q. Do you only have low-priced freight on your board? A. No, we have a wide range of brokers, shippers, and third parties who all actively post loads on
our
website. This results in a wide range of rates on available loads. Keep in mind that rates on
almost every load is negotiable and that some companies that have lower rates offer "quick pay"
programs which sometimes offset the difference in payment.

Q. What is an MC#? A. MC# stands for Motor Carrier Number. An MC# is assigned by the FMCSA to carriers, brokers, and
freight forwarders who have registered and been authorized to operate in interstate commerce. For
an MC# to remain active, the entity must maintain the proper levels of insurance or surety bond
and keep that information current with the FMCSA.

Q. What are the abbreviations used for trailer types? A. See the table below:
| Abbr. |
Trailer Type |
Abbr. |
Trailer Type |
| AC |
Auto Carrier |
R |
Reefer |
| BT |
B-Train |
RA |
Reefer - Air Ride |
| C |
Container - Regular |
RG |
Removable Gooseneck |
| CI |
Container - Insulated |
RX |
Reefer w/Pallet Exchange |
| CR |
Container - Refrigerated |
RZ |
Reefer - HazMat |
| DD |
Double Drop |
SD |
Step Deck |
| DT |
Dump Truck |
ST |
Stretch Trailer |
| F |
Flatbed |
TA |
Tanker |
| FS |
Flatbed w/Sides |
V |
Van |
| FT |
Flatbed w/Tarps |
VA |
Van - Air Ride |
| FZ |
Flatbed - HazMat |
VC |
Van w/Curtains |
| HB |
Hopper Bottom |
VI |
Van - Insulated |
| HS |
HotShot |
VV |
Van - Vented |
| LB |
LowBoy |
VX |
Van w/Pallet Exchange |
| MX |
Maxi |
VZ |
Van - HazMat |
| PO |
Power Only |
WF |
Walking Floor |
Q. What does "Call" mean? A. The "Call" listing under payment amount indicates that the payment on the load is negotiable.
Listing the payment amount on a load is optional on our system and if a Broker or Shipper does not
have this payment information available then the system defaults to "Call". This generally means
that the company who has the load may have an amount that they would like to pay for the load, but
are willing to consider other offers.
Tip: Keep in mind even if a payment field is provided that the amount is still
negotiable.

Q. Why am I not getting any responses on my load postings? A. There may be several reasons why you are getting little response to your loads postings. First,
have you checked what credit score is posted on your account? Many carriers will base their
decision to call on a load based on the credit rating of the company. Second, how often do you
update the loads on our system? When searching for loads there is an option to only view the loads
that were posted within the last 1 or 2 hours. Many of our members make the assumption that if a
load has been posted for more than 2 to 4 hours, it has been covered. It is helpful to be
sure your postings remain accurate and updated throughout the day. Another problem may be that
your loads have incorrectly spelled cities or states in the postings. A carrier will not be able
to see your postings if they are not listed correctly. Finally, make sure that the company
information you have on file with us is not outdated or incorrect. If a carrier sees the wrong MC
number on file with us they cannot check on a company's bond or authority information, which may
deter them from contacting you. Also, if your contact information is not correct then they simply
are unable to get in touch with you.
